Rui Maximo has created another amazing workload poster, this time for Microsoft Lync 2010. This poster gives you a great visual view of how protocols work for various Lync workloads. These include IM and Presence, A/V and Web Conferencing, Application Sharing, Enterprise Voice, and even the Central Management Service. In many organizations, executives have administrative assistants who answer their office phones for them. This is easily accomplished in OCS 2007 R2 and Lync Server 2010 by using call delegation. However there may be instances where an executive wishes for friends and family to be able to reach him directly and bypass his assistant. Using Lync Server 2010 private lines, a Lync administrator can assign a second telephone number to any...
